The installation wizard is automatic, once you've configured your web.config and the database and copied the files to the server, browse to the server and the wizard starts.

I keep seeing the recommendation to rename Release.config to Web.config but I don't think that step is necessary in newer versions of DNN.  Can someone please corroborate?  I don't think I did it manually for my install of 4.5.0, specially now with the use of the database in App_data with SQL 2005.  It just works.

Also, there is a mention of the source Zip for installation.  I would recommend you to use the "Install" package of DNN to create your site.  Even if you want to do module development, the Install package is the way to go.  That is, unless you want to work with the code for the DNN Core (which is really deep waters).

theres differences between the different distributions. In the _install package the web.config already exists, in the _upgrade package it doesn't, as if it did it would overwrite the existing package when copied over an earlier install. In the starter kit, when you open it the welcome page will guide you through the necessary steps.

The choice of package depends on what you plan on using the portal for. If you're just looking to get an install together then use the install package, but if you plan on doing module development, then it's good to use the source package. The upgrade package is designed for upgrades only

I've seen a number of reports of issues with the install wizard with the same error you have. It's a relatively small percentage, as the majority of people are having success with it. What version of the OS are you running, and what browser version are you using - i suspect it's a browser specific error as it looks an issue with the javascript (though we have some reports of people having issues when their database server is using case sensitive collations)
